The vehicle was a totally standard car, fitted with sat-nav, CD autochanger and rear DVD player screens. Powered by its twin-turbo 2.7 litre diesel, the aluminium-body XJ averaged 53.5mpg on the voyage.
Geoff Cousins, MD of Jaguar UK, said: "We were always optimistic that the XJ Diesel could do this, but the figures were beyond our best expectations. They show that the XJ diesel is a truly economical luxury car...and proves that the XJ really is one of the most environmentally friendly cars in its class."
